Graphics chipmaker Nvidia has announced the RTX 3060 Ti, the first and cheapest member of RTX 3060 series graphics cards. It costs ₹35,900 (GST exclusive) and will be available for purchase from December 2.
The entry-level GPU is based on Nvidia's new Ampere architecture and is faster than the previous generation RTX 2080 Super GPU, which had nearly twice the pricing.
Nvidia is targeting the GeForce RTX 3060 Ti towards 1080p and 1440p gaming and supports real-time ray tracing, DLSS as well as NVIDIA’s RTX apps.
